Why Serving Bowls With Lids Are Necessary

I’ve found that serving bowls with lids are incredibly useful because they help keep food fresh for longer. When I prepare meals ahead of time or save leftovers, the lid protects the food from air, dust, and odors. This means my dishes stay tastier and safer to eat, especially when I’m storing them in the fridge or carrying them to another place.

I also like serving bowls with lids because they make serving and transporting food much easier. Whether I’m bringing a dish to a family gathering, picnic, or potluck, the lid helps prevent spills and keeps everything neatly covered. It gives me peace of mind knowing my food stays secure while I move it around.

Another reason I find them necessary is that they help keep my kitchen more organized. I can stack them better, store food efficiently, and reduce the need for extra plastic wrap or foil. For me, serving bowls with lids are a simple but practical choice that saves time, reduces mess, and makes everyday cooking and serving much more convenient.

What I Look for in a Good Serving Bowl With Lid

When I shop for serving bowls with lids, I pay attention to a few key things. First, I check the material. I usually prefer glass or high-quality stainless steel because they feel durable and easy to clean. If I want something lightweight, I sometimes consider BPA-free plastic.

I also look at the lid fit. In my experience, a tight-fitting lid matters a lot because it helps prevent spills and keeps food covered properly. I make sure the bowl is the right size for the meals I usually prepare, whether that’s salad, pasta, fruit, or leftovers.

Material Matters

I’ve found that different materials work better for different needs:

  • Glass: Great for serving and reheating, and I like that it doesn’t hold odors.
  • Stainless Steel: Durable and long-lasting, which I appreciate for everyday use.
  • Plastic: Lightweight and convenient, especially when I need something easy to carry.
  • Ceramic: Attractive for table serving, though I handle it more carefully because it can chip.

Size and Capacity

For me, size is one of the biggest factors. I like having a set with different capacities so I can use one bowl for small side dishes and another for larger meals. If I’m buying just one, I usually choose a medium or large size because it gives me more flexibility.

Lid Quality and Seal

I always test the lid before buying if I can. A secure lid gives me confidence when I’m storing leftovers or taking food to gatherings. Some lids snap on firmly, while others simply rest on top. I personally prefer lids that lock or seal more tightly, especially for travel.

Ease of Cleaning

Cleaning is important to me because I use my kitchen items often. I look for bowls that are dishwasher-safe whenever possible. I also prefer smooth surfaces and simple lid designs because they’re easier to wash and less likely to trap food.

Microwave, Oven, and Freezer Safety

I always check whether the bowl is safe for the microwave, oven, or freezer, depending on how I plan to use it. Glass bowls are often my choice when I want reheating flexibility. For freezer storage, I make sure the lid can handle cold temperatures without cracking or warping.

Style and Presentation

Since I sometimes use serving bowls directly on the table, I care about appearance too. I like bowls that look nice enough for guests but are still practical for everyday use. A simple, clean design usually works best for me because it fits many occasions.

My Final Buying Tip

If I had to give one piece of advice, it would be to buy a serving bowl with lid that matches your real routine, not just your ideal one. I choose bowls based on how I actually cook, store, and serve food. That way, I know I’ll use them often and get good value from the purchase.
